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
816 96237 05117663
40 15034
40 15034
15 6984 5181384633
All about undefined
Interested in learning more?
40 15034
15 6984 5181384633
See more
525 0480
9864355664 1781 97295009 97655 285
See more
82656 6647018406
311 52208 50 1700558 80
See more